Anna Shay McEntee is a fitness and holistic health care practitioner. She worked as the director of the Health Education and Stress Management in the Santurce Medical Mall in Puerto Rico. She was a regular columnist on fitness and health for the newspaper “San Juan Star” and other newsletters published by the Santurce Medical Mall and United Health Care in Puerto Rico.
Today, Anna resides in Wellington, Florida where she teaches and trains the largest polo and equestrian community. She continues her work as a Continuing Education Specialist and a presenter in mind/body exercise, nutrition and stress management for the American Council on Exercise, Aerobic and Fitness Association of America, Bio Sensory Systematic T.O.U.C.H. Training™, California Medical Board of Acupuncturists, California Board of Registered Nursing and the International Macrobiotic Shiatsu Society. She is a member of teaching staff and faculty for the health Classic Inc. Conferences, offering accredited workshops on fitness and holistic medicine.
Anna is a Certified Pilates Instructor™ (Full Certification), Certified Group Fitness Instructor and Personal Trainer with American Council on Exercise and Aerobic Training International, Certified Water Aerobic Instructor with Aquatic Exercise Association, Certified Yoga Instructor with White Lotus Foundation of California, Iynger School of the Yoga Institute of Miami and the International Yoga Teacher Association. Anna is also a certified practitioner with American Oriental Body Therapy Association.
Anna is passionate about her work and her dream is to create a wellness center that is affordable for everyone. She wishes to guide people to have elevated consciousness and heightened awareness in mind, body and spirit to create a better world.
